From dbac8767714d1c1dad1e257a52047c32ff41a347 Mon Sep 17 00:00:00 2001 From: peijiankang Date: Wed, 14 May 2025 17:54:27 +0800 Subject: [PATCH] fix unlink error (cherry picked from commit 39bea89e69dc1c9907909592b376cfc232fc40de) --- ukui-biometric-manager.spec | 13 ++++++++++--- 1 file changed, 10 insertions(+), 3 deletions(-) diff --git a/ukui-biometric-manager.spec b/ukui-biometric-manager.spec index 7418529..e9d69ca 100644 --- a/ukui-biometric-manager.spec +++ b/ukui-biometric-manager.spec @@ -1,6 +1,6 @@ Name: ukui-biometric-manager Version: 3.1.2 -Release: 3 +Release: 4 Summary: manager for biometric authentication License: GPL-2+ URL: http://www.ukui.org @@ -54,10 +54,14 @@ make INSTALL_ROOT=%{buildroot} install %clean rm -rf $RPM_BUILD_ROOT -%post +%posttrans ln -sf /usr/bin/biometric-manager /usr/bin/ukui-biometric-manager + %postun -unlink /usr/bin/ukui-biometric-manager +if [ -e "/usr/bin/ukui-biometric-manager" ]; then + unlink /usr/bin/ukui-biometric-manager +fi + %files %{_bindir}/biometric-manager @@ -68,6 +72,9 @@ unlink /usr/bin/ukui-biometric-manager %{_datadir}/kylin-user-guide/data/guide %changelog +* Wed May 14 2025 peijiankang - 3.1.2-4 +- fix unlink error + * Tue May 30 2023 peijiankang - 3.1.2-3 - fix unlink error -- Gitee